How much does it cost to live alone in Ballykelly?

Living alone in Ballykelly usually costs more than sharing, as you cover the full rent and utilities yourself. On average, property to rent in Ballykelly costs around 700 £ per month, with cheaper options from 700 £.

Typical monthly expenses include:

  • utilities (£150–£250)
  • groceries (£180–£280)
  • transport (£150–£200)
  • council tax (£120–£180)

Everyday costs like phone plans or streaming services usually add around £30–£60 per month. The average monthly salary in the UK is roughly £2,300–£2,600 after tax, so careful budgeting is essential when living alone in Ballykelly.

How to rent in Ballykelly?

Renting in Ballykelly starts with searching on Rentola and then contacting landlords to arrange viewings. If you're interested, you’ll likely need to provide references and pass a credit check. Once approved, you pay a deposit and sign a rental agreement. Having your documents ready helps speed up the process.
